sethcheek July 29th, 2001 06:08 PM

Intel Pentium III 650MHz
320MB PC133
VooDoo3 3500 16MB
Sound Blaster Live! Value
Windows 2000 Pro SP2
NO patch (Don't want to screw up a good thing...)

The Double Buffer instead of Triple Buffer setting is what made it run for me...Poor Voodoo3 doesn't like to triple buffer.

IAmGhostDog July 29th, 2001 06:55 PM

Pentium 3 450Mhz
1st Generation GeForce 32Mb 256
Original SoundBlaster Live Platinum
256Mb PC100 RAM
A couple of tips:
I was having problems with the game locking up,I went to nVIDIA's website and downloaded
Detonator3 v12.41, backed off on my resolution to 1024x768x16, the game runs fine.
